Siggie, Leo, Max, and Tiger Penoza






Siggie, Leo, Max and Tiger belong to Tom and Cherie Penoza of New Castle, DE. Siggie and Leo are 6 years old. Max and Tiger are brothers and are 11 months old. Siggie is a chocolate dachshund. He was born in Lewes, Delaware. Leo was rescued in early September 1998 from Lebanon, Ohio. He is a dapple. He was dumped out of a car and abandoned in Ohio. We flew out and got him at Kathleen's Wiener Ranch then flew him home. Max and Tiger were born in Michigan. Their mother was rescued at the Weiner Ranch and she was cared for by Deb Boucher Dachshund Rescue of Ohio in Michigan at the dachshund rescue. Once she had Max and Tiger she was nursed back to health and adopted. Max came home with us but Tiger was very sick and stayed in Michigan. He almost died and Deb took him to Michigan State University where he was operated on and had a complete recovery. Tom went and got him and he flew to his new home in Delaware first class on USAir. He was reunited with his brother, Max, and they are best friends. All four get along great.
